🏆 St Joey’s Term 3 Sports Wrap-Up! 🏆
What a term it’s been for our St Joey’s sporting superstars! From athletics tracks to gala days, our students have been giving it their all, showing off their skills, sportsmanship, and school spirit. Here’s a snapshot of the action-packed term:
Athletics All-Stars
Beenleigh Zone Athletics: 36 students competed, with 15 qualifying for the Championship Day and St Joey’s taking home the overall Percentage Trophy!
Championship Day: Special shoutout to Marlina E-N and Tama B for making the Beenleigh Zone team and competing at Pacific District and South Coast carnivals.
Catholic Zone Athletics: Over 40 students represented us in Division 1, smashing PBs and earning Top 4 finishes!
Gala Day Greatness
Basketball: Our teams shone at the Molten CBSQ tournament, with the girls going undefeated! Players’ Player awards went to Georgia C, Isla K, Max A, and Godfrey P.
Netball: Two teams competed at the Western Districts Gala, and Georgia C & Ivy R even met Queensland Firebirds co-captain Hulita Veve!
Touch Football: 70+ students hit the Yarrabilba Carnival, playing their hearts out and making us proud.
Soccer: Grade 5 & 6 teams competed at Pacific Pines, with Grade 5 making the finals and showing true Joeys grit.
Monday Sport & More
Trinity College Matches: Grade 5 & 6 students trained hard and put their skills to the test in Basketball and Touch Football against Trinity College.
Prep–2 Sports Day & League Stars: Our youngest Joeys had a blast with fun activities and Rugby League Tag sessions, cheered on by our awesome Grade 6 helpers.
Before School Run Club: Students from Grades 3–6 clocked up their laps and finished the year strong!
Individual Achievements
Macy (Grade 5): Danced her way to gold in the USA, winning multiple routines and ranking in the top 20 for her age group!
Georgia (Grade 6): Played up two age groups at State Age Netball Champs and was named player of the match!
Elijah (Grade 1): Youngest competitor for Beenleigh TSKF Karate, earning podium finishes at regionals and state!
Cooper (Grade 3): Racing go-karts for a sponsored team, already a club champion!
Tae Kwon Do Crew: Many students earned new belts after months of dedication.
Blake E & Max A: Nominated for the REES-WILLIAMS Junior Boy Award for kindness, respect, and values in basketball.
